Synopsis: Gloria, a hard-loving, hard-drinking, hard-writing novelist picks up Billy, a young transvestite as her next sex toy. After she rapes him, he falls hard for her and her rough ways. As a female impersonator, he has a very healthy obsession with women which becomes severely focused on Gloria. Soon her cousin Lydia arrives, and Billy is forced to make some serious decisions to prove his feelings to Gloria. [More]
